Neovascularization induced by hyperoxia is inhibited by a single dose of SRPK inhibitor, SRPIN340. A, low power fluorescence micrograph of FITC-labeled lectin staining of retinal whole mounts with areas of NV (white) and ischemic (orange) outlined. B, higher power view of a single retinal quadrant, with angiogenic areas highlighted by arrowheads. C, high power view of retinal angiogenic area showing sprouting endothelial cells. D, quantification of neovascular areas shows a small but significant inhibition by a single injection of 1 μl of 10 μm SRPIN340 1 day after removal from oxygen. E, ischemic area was also reduced in these mice. F, normal area was consequently increased. G, data shown as relative to control, uninjected contralateral eye. Neo, neovacular; isch, ischemia; Norm, normal.
